About Wörterbar PR & Service

Since our foundation in 1991 our orders have come from SMEs, associations and trade-show organisers in the fields of sensors, image processing and automation. Our customers have their location in Germany, the Netherlands, Switzerland, the United Kingdom, the USA or China. Dr. Gerhard Weissler, the proprietor or Wörterbar PR & Service, with its office in Hungen – to the north of Frankfurt am Main -, has had more than 20 years of experience as chief editor of the trade journal, Sensor Report.
